I'm sure I'm not the first to post about this but I've searched two different nuke help forums and have not be able to find any "specific" help for this problem.

I have installed phpnuke 7.7 in a directory of www.mydomain.com/site and created all the tables in the database. I have run tests on my database connection and it is connecting fine and showing all table names etc. If I try to view www.mydomain.com/site/admin.php I get a blank white page but I can view source and there is some code there.

This is the same for index.php

Any suggestions?

Is there any luck on this?
installed phpnuke 7.7, created db, set the permissions and get blank page on index.php and admin.php
installed postnuke 750, works fine on main page, however all php pages go blnk white when I change to a theme other than the default theme.
themes installed, permissions set, db installed and users created.
things I have done
removed apache2 via yum ( using fedora core 4 btw ) and reinstalled via tarball, followed php/mysql instructs to the T. Downgraded from php5 to php 4.4 and then to 4.3. downgraded mysql and even upgraded to beta. I am not seeing any errors being generated in error_log and access_log in apache shows the proper php file being accessed. in phpnuke php pages are showing with 0 content and postnuke will work fine if I leave everything with the default theme and never change it. Also I disabled SeLinux and turned off the firewall in fedora to rule out any file lockdown problems due to SeLinux.
If anyone have any insight on why these annoying blank php pages are showing up I would appreciate it.
